发明名称 Light source device, display apparatus, and method of manufacturing light source device
摘要 Provided are a light source device capable of uniformly illuminating, a display apparatus, and a method of manufacturing the light source device. Since a reflection sheet is adhered to a light guide plate through an adhesive layer, deflection thereof is suppressed. Since dot parts are filled in openings of an optical layer, it would be difficult for the dot parts to be distorted by an outer force. In addition, since the dot parts are formed by forming the optical layer and the adhesive layer in a large area in which an occurrence of distortion during forming is minimal, it would be difficult for the dot parts to be distorted during forming the same. Therefore, an occurrence of luminance unevenness caused by the deflection of the reflection sheet or the distortion of the dot parts may be suppressed. From the above result, it is possible to uniformly illuminate by the light source device.

主权项 1. A light source device, comprising: a reflection sheet having light reflecting properties; a light guide plate in which the reflection sheet is disposed on a side of one surface thereof and which is configured to emit light emitted by a light source unit from a front surface thereof; an optical layer which is formed on the one surface, provided with openings, and configured to guide the light incident on the one surface to a side of the front surface, wherein the optical layer has a lower light refractive index than the light guide plate; and an adhesive layer which is formed on a rear surface of the optical layer and the one surface which is exposed from the openings, and has light scattering properties or light reflecting properties, wherein the reflection sheet is adhered to the light guide plate through the adhesive layer.
